The AC has an important role in ensuring the integrity of actuarial processes and the proper assessment of PPS Insurance Group Companies’ risk philosophy from an actuarial perspective, strategy, policies, financial and operational processes and controls, as well as assessments of major risks from an actuarial perspective. The AC’s activities are focused on considering actuarial assumptions and experience, product pricing and design, valuation results, risk metrics and reporting guidelines and practices adopted by the Head of Actuarial Control Function and the Company Actuaries, as well as other actuarial matters as applicable to PPS Insurance and any of its subsidiaries operating a life or short-term insurance licence. The AC acts as an independent adviser to the PPS Insurance, PPS Namibia and PPS Short-Term Insurance Boards and has the following primary responsibilities: ~ ~ To assist the boards in fulfilling their oversight responsibilities regarding: • the accuracy and integrity of the actuarial statements; • compliance with actuarial, legal and regulatory requirements; and • the performance of the Actuarial Functions of PPS Insurance and PPS Short-Term Insurance. ~ ~ Toassist theboards in the executionof their fiduciary duties regarding the oversight of the reinsurance arrangements and risk transfer processes. ~ ~ To assist the boards with the execution of their responsibilities relating to the Own Risk and Solvency Assessment (ORSA). ~ ~ To provide a sounding board for the Head of Actuarial Control Function and the Company Actuaries inmaking recommendations to theboards and to consider, for tabling at board meetings, the recommendations of the Head of Actuarial Control Function and the Company Actuaries.
